Who is the enforcement body for accounting standards within Australia?
The Australian Accounting Standards Board (AASB) is an Australian Government agency that develops and maintains financial reporting standards applicable to entities in the private and public sectors of the Australian economy.
Which body is responsible to International Accounting Standards Board?
The International Accounting Standards Board (IASB) is an independent, private-sector body that develops and approves International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RSs). The IASB operates under the oversight of the IFRS Foundation.
What is the purpose of Australian accounting standards?
The mission of the AASB is to develop and maintain high quality financial reporting standards for all sectors of the Australian economy and contribute, through leadership and talent, to the development of global financial reporting standards and be recognised as facilitating the inclusion of the Australian community in …
What are the three professional accounting bodies in Australia?
In Australia, there are three legally recognised local professional accounting bodies: the Institute of Public Accountants (IPA), CPA Australia (CPA) and Chartered Accountants Australia and New Zealand (CA).
Who is responsible for the development of international accounting standards?
the International Accounting Standards Board
About the International Accounting Standards Board (Board) Board members are responsible for the development and publication of IFRS Standards, including the IFRS for SMEs Standard.
